Acceptability of the Specialist Psychotherapy with Emotion for Anorexia in Kent and Sussex psychological therapy for adults with anorexia nervosa: The SPEAKS study

1. Referred into the All Age Eating Disorder Service in Kent or Sussex Eating Disorder Services and meet criteria for the service (i.e. they are registered with a GP in the catchment area)
2. At assessment, meet the Diagnostic and Statistical Manual V (DSM V) criteria for anorexia nervosa or OSFED (other specified feeding or eating Disorder) of anorexic type
3. Aged 18 years or above
4. BMI >15 kg/m2 and currently stable in weight (i.e. not dropping more than 0.5 kg a week)
5. Have sufficient English language abilities to complete a talking therapy
1. Presenting with considerable physical risk or psychological risk, including active suicidal thoughts and plans
2. Comorbidity that would take priority for treatment
3. Alcohol/substance dependency
4. Participating in another treatment trial
5. Have a learning disability
6. Pregnant
7. Severely ill referrals with BMI <15 kg/m2 or other severe medical risks (indicated by blood pressure, muscle strength and blood chemistry)
